The GNU system made it possible to use a computer and have freedom. The GNU Project's contribution was a legally enforcable license to ensure share-and-share-alike for authors who chose to use the legal system to enforce their politics. The GNU Project developed a free operating system, GNU. (See http://www.gnu.org/gnu/the-gnu-project.html.) To do this, we developed many programs, which are GNU packages. We still develop more GNU packages and also accept existing programs into the GNU Project when their developers wish. As a supporting activity, we also developed a license for releasing these programs as free software and defend freedom for all users. That is the GNU GPL.
